#599725 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#599725 is composed of 34.9% red, 59.2% green and 14.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 41.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 75.5% yellow and 40.8% black. It has a hue angle of 92.6 degrees, a saturation of 60.6% and a lightness of 36.9%. #599725 color hex could be obtained by blending #b2ff4a with #002f00. Closest websafe color is: #669933.

Shades and Tints of #599725

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050902 is the darkest color, while #fbfdf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#599725

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5d6458 is the less saturated color, while #56bb01 is the most saturated one.
